Concrete leveling services involve restoring the evenness and stability of uneven or sunken concrete surfaces. Over time, concrete slabs can shift due to soil movement, moisture changes, or natural settling, leading to uneven walkways, driveways, patios, or garage floors. Professional contractors use specialized techniques, such as injecting foam or other materials beneath the slab, to lift and level the surface. This process helps improve the appearance of the property and ensures safer, more functional outdoor and indoor spaces without the need for complete replacement.
This service addresses common problems caused by uneven concrete, including tripping hazards, water pooling, and structural stress on nearby structures. When concrete slabs settle or crack, they can create dangerous conditions for foot traffic and vehicles. Additionally, uneven surfaces can cause water to drain improperly, leading to further erosion or damage. Concrete leveling provides an efficient solution to these issues, helping to maintain safety, prevent further deterioration, and extend the lifespan of existing concrete structures.

The overview below groups typical Concrete Leveling proj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- for minor leveling or patching,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, making it a common choice for simple fixes.
Moderate Projects - larger areas or more extensive leveling work usually cost between $600 and $1,500. These projects are frequently encountered and represent a typical mid-range cost for concrete leveling services.
Large or Complex Jobs - projects involving significant surface areas or challenging conditions can range from $1,500 to $3,000. Fewer projects push into this higher tier, but local pros can handle these more demanding jobs.
Full Replacement - when concrete needs to be entirely replaced instead of leveled, costs generally start around $3,000 and can exceed $5,000 for large-scale projects. This represents the most extensive and costly option available from local service providers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is concrete leveling? Concrete leveling is a process that raises and stabilizes uneven or sinking concrete surfaces to restore their original position and improve safety.
How do local contractors perform concrete leveling? They typically use techniques like foam jacking or mudjacking to lift and level the concrete efficiently and minimally invasively.
Is concrete leveling suitable for all types of concrete surfaces? It is most effective on driveways, sidewalks, patios, and other flat surfaces that have settled or shifted over time.
What are the benefits of choosing concrete leveling services? Proper leveling can enhance the appearance, prevent further damage, and improve safety around the affected area.
